Anyways, three upcoming HTC phones and their specs have been leaked before HTC appears at the Mobile World Congress in Barcelona. The three phones include HTC Desire otherwise known as the Bravo, the HTC Legend and the HTC Touch HD Mini. Not a bad haul. A quick rundown of the specs are below.
Desire:

CPU Speed - 1 GHz
Platform - Android™ 2.1 (Éclair) with HTC SenseTM
Memory - ROM: 512 MB, RAM: 576 MB
Dimensions - (LxWxT) 119 x 60 x 11.9 mm (4.7 x 2.36 x 0.47 inches)
Weight - 135 grams (4.76 ounces) with battery
Display - 3.7-inch AMOLED touch-sensitive screen with 480 X 800 WVGA resolution

Legend:

CPU speed - 600 MHz
Platform - Android™ 2.1 (Éclair) with HTC Sense
Memory ROM - 512 MB, RAM: 384 MB
Dimensions - (LxWxT) 112 x 56.3 x 11.5 mm (4.41 x 2.22 x 0.45 inches)
Weight - 126 grams (4.44 ounces) with battery
Display - 3.2-inch AMOLED touch-sensitive screen with 320 X 480 HVGA resolution

Here are the full specs of the HTC Desire
« Reply #1 on: February 16, 2010, 01:36:36 AM »

Pining for Google's latest pin-up?

Who needs a Nexus One when HTC are set to announce the Bravo at the MWC conference in Barcelona tomorrow!

The handset looks to be set to match the N1 specs, including that glorious 3.7" AMOLED screen, but with added HTC flavour! The Bravo is expected to include an optical navigation stick, the same 1GHz Snapdragon CPU from Qualcomm, and HTC's Sense UI running on top plus the addition of a FM Radio.

Edit: Full specs now available, and it seems to be christened the 'HTC Desire'!

HTC Desire (Bravo) Specifications
•CPU Speed - 1 GHz
•Platform - Android™ 2.1 (Éclair) with HTC SenseTM
•Memory - ROM: 512 MB, RAM: 576 MB
•Dimensions - (LxWxT) 119 x 60 x 11.9 mm (4.7 x 2.36 x 0.47 inches)
•Weight - 135 grams (4.76 ounces) with battery
•Display - 3.7-inch AMOLED touch-sensitive screen with 480 X 800 WVGA resolution
•Network - HSPA/WCDMA:
◦Europe/Asia: 900/2100 MHz
◦Upload speed of up to 2 Mbps and download speed of up to 7.2 Mbps
•Quad-band GSM/GPRS/EDGE:
◦850/900/1800/1900 MHz (Band frequency, HSPA availability, and data speed are operator dependent.)
•Onscreen navigation - Optical Trackball
•GPS - Internal GPS antenna
•Sensors -
◦Proximity sensor
◦Ambient light sensor
◦G-Sensor
◦Digital compass
•Connectivity - Bluetooth® 2.1 with FTP/OPP for file transfer, A2DP for wireless stereo headsets,
and PBAP for phonebook access from the car kit
•Wi-Fi® - IEEE 802.11 b/g
•3.5 mm stereo audio jack
•Standard Micro-USB (5-pin micro-USB 2.0)
•Camera - 5 megapixel color camera with auto focus and flashlight
•Audio supported formats
◦Playback: .aac, .amr, .ogg, .m4a, .mid, .mp3, .wav, .wma,
◦Recording: .amr
•Video supported formats
◦Playback: .3gp, .3g2, .mp4, .wmv
◦· Recording: .3gp
•Battery - Rechargeable Lithium-ion battery
•Capacity - 1400 mAh
•Talk time:
◦Up to 390 minutes for WCDMA
◦Up to 400 minutes for GSM
•Standby time:
◦Up to 360 hours for WCDMA
◦Up to 340 hours for GSM
•Expansion Slot - microSD™ memory card (SD 2.0 compatible)
•AC Adapter Voltage range/frequency - 100 ~ 240 V AC, 50/60 Hz
•DC output - 5 V and 1 A
•Special Feature - Friend Stream
